The Musée d’art de Pully is celebrating Auguste Veillon, the Swiss landscape artist active in the second half of the 19th century.

Alongside views of Swiss mountains and lakes, the exhibition presents the painter’s Orientalist work, representing Tunisia, Egypt, and the Holy Land.
